Defensive discharge Jurrell Casey’s series with the Broncos ended after one season.
ESPN’s Adam Schefter reports and PFT confirmed, through a league source, that the Broncos launched Casey. Casey was set to have more than $ 11.8 million against the cap and the team clears that space as a result of the move.
The Broncos sent Casey a choice in the seventh round for the Titans last March. He started the first three games of the season, but lost the rest of the year with a broken bicep.
Casey has made it to the Pro Bowl in each of his last five seasons with the Titans, so some team will likely be willing to bet on a rebound if he can show that he is healthy enough to play.
The Broncos also released cornerback AJ Bouye this month and the two moves opened up about $ 24 million in space for the team to use this offseason.
